With oversized handlebars being de rigueur for road and mountain bikes these days, you need a stem that is equally as stiff and strong. Syntace took the design of its legendary F99 stem and parlayed it into the F109, to fit oversized 31. 8mm handlebar clamps. Syntace forged the Force 109 from high-strength aluminum alloy. This material, along with 3D forging, keeps strength at a maximum and weight at a minimum. In addition, it's equipped with titanium bolts to shave every gram of weight possible. The faceplate makes handlebar changes quick, and you won't have to contort your fingers to squeeze a hex wrench into an awkwardly-placed bolt head. The "bed" for the handlebar is 20 degrees deeper than a standard 180, at 200 degrees. This allows your handlebar to sit deeper into the stem, which helps to decrease bar flex and increase fatigue life. The Syntace Force 109 Stem is available in several lengths and degree options: 60mm/6deg, 75mm/6deg, 90mm/6deg, 90mm/17deg, 100mm/6deg, 100mm/17deg, 110mm/6deg, 110mm/17deg, 120mm/6deg, and 135mm/6deg. It comes in the color Black.

I would recommend being extremely careful tightening the titanium bolts that come with this stem. If you follow the directions, using a torque wrench, and don't tighten them beyond 6nm you will be fine. If you don't have torque wrench or just don't want to hassle with it you should get some steel bolts. I forgot and was thinking it was 9nm and I snapped one off. If you've never tried to get a titanium bolt with no head on it out of a threaded hole take my advice...you don't want to. Nevertheless, the Syntace rep was VERY accomodating and sent me a new stem!!!. One other thing I like about this stem is the "snap fit feature". My bars actually snap in allowing for easy adjustment before tightening the bolts.
